The Saab 340 is a legendary regional workhorse, and in , it remains a favorite for pilots who enjoy the tactile feel of twin-turboprop operations. While neither of the major add-ons—the Leading Edge Simulations (LES) Saab 340A or the Carenado Saab 340B —currently has a native X-Plane 12 release, both are flyable through community updates and specific installation workarounds.
